How to get an accurate Brickanta quote

  1. Ask for pricing at your actual volume, not the headline tier — per-seat and usage pricing diverge fast.
  2. Ask what happens at renewal. Uplift caps matter more than the first-year discount.
  3. Get the onboarding, migration and support costs in writing separately.
  4. Ask for a month-to-month option. If it does not exist, that tells you about the annual price.
  5. Quote a competitor from the table below. It is the fastest way to a real number.
